But did you know that balloons have been around for quite a while? The earliest versions weren’t quite the colorful spheres we know and love today. History suggests that the earliest balloons were made from animal bladders! Those were primarily used for entertainment or rituals. Fast forward to the 19th century, and the invention of rubber balloons marked the start of the modern balloon era, paving the way for mass production and widespread use.

Latex: The Classic Choice

Ah, latex! The classic choice, the old faithful, the… well, you get the idea. Latex balloons are the balloons most of us grew up with.

  • What is Latex? Latex is a natural substance harvested from rubber trees. Think of it as the tree’s “sap,” but way more useful for birthday parties.
  • Properties: What makes latex so great? It’s super elastic, meaning it can stretch a whole lot without breaking (ideal for those extra-large inflations!). Plus, it’s biodegradable, which is a big win for the environment (more on that later!).
  • How it’s Made: The process starts with tapping rubber trees, collecting the latex, and then adding some magic (okay, chemicals) to stabilize it. Then, the latex is dipped onto balloon-shaped molds, dried, and voila! A balloon is born.
  • Why We Love It: Latex is relatively cheap to produce, and it’s incredibly flexible, allowing for various shapes and sizes. Plus, that whole biodegradable thing makes us feel a little better about our party decorations.

Rubber: A Durable Alternative

While often used interchangeably with “latex,” rubber balloons usually refer to those made with a slightly different, often synthetic, rubber compound.

  • Rubber’s Edge: Rubber balloons often boast greater durability and weather resistance compared to their latex cousins. Think of them as the tougher, more resilient sibling.
  • Production Process: The production of rubber balloons involves mixing synthetic rubber compounds, adding pigments for color, and then molding and curing the material into the desired balloon shape.
  • Latex vs. Rubber: While latex wins on biodegradability, rubber balloons can last longer, especially in outdoor conditions. If you need balloons that can withstand a bit more wear and tear, rubber might be your go-to.

Foil (Mylar): For Shapes and Shine

Now, let’s get to the glamorous side of balloon materials. Foil, often called Mylar, balloons are the shiny, eye-catching stars of the balloon world.

  • What is Foil? These aren’t your grandma’s aluminum foil. Mylar is a type of stretched polyester film known for its strength and reflectivity.
  • Making the Magic: The manufacturing process involves coating a thin plastic film with a metallic layer, then cutting and sealing it into the desired shape. Heat sealing is key here to keep that precious air from escaping.
  • Why They’re Awesome: Foil balloons can hold complex shapes that latex can only dream of. Plus, that reflective surface? Instant party upgrade. They also hold air much longer than latex, meaning less re-inflating!

Plastic: Economical and Versatile

Last but not least, we have plastic balloons. These are often the budget-friendly option, and while they might not have the same natural charm as latex or the shine of foil, they have their own advantages.

  • Plastic Power: Plastic balloons are made from various types of plastic films, offering a cost-effective alternative.
  • How They’re Made: The process typically involves heat-sealing two sheets of plastic film together, creating an airtight enclosure.
  • Why Choose Plastic? Plastic balloons are usually the cheapest option, and they can be printed with intricate designs. They’re also quite versatile in terms of shape and size, making them suitable for promotional purposes and large-scale events.

The Science Inside: Understanding the Properties of Air

Ever wonder why a balloon inflates and holds its shape? It’s not just magic; it’s science! Air might seem like nothing, but it has some pretty cool properties that make balloons work. Let’s dive into the science of air and balloons.

Pressure: Keeping the Shape

Air pressure is like an invisible force constantly pushing on everything, including the inside of a balloon. When you blow air into a balloon, you’re increasing the air pressure inside. This internal pressure pushes outwards, stretching the balloon material until it equals the external pressure from the air outside. This balance is what keeps the balloon inflated and gives it its shape.

Think of it this way: if you take a balloon up a mountain (higher altitude), where the external air pressure is lower, the balloon will expand a bit because the internal pressure has less resistance. Squeeze a balloon, and you’ll feel the air pressure pushing back against your hand!

Volume: Defining the Balloon’s Capacity

The volume of a balloon is simply the amount of space it takes up. As you inflate a balloon, you’re increasing its volume. But volume isn’t just about size; it’s also affected by temperature and pressure. If you heat a balloon, the air inside expands, increasing the volume (that’s why balloons can pop in hot cars!). Conversely, increasing the external pressure will compress the balloon, decreasing its volume. While air-filled balloons aren’t designed for lift like helium balloons, understanding volume is the first step in understanding the force of buoyancy.

Temperature: A Hot Air Affair (or Not)

Temperature plays a big role in air density. When you heat air, the molecules move faster and spread out, making the air less dense. This is why hot air rises. So, if you have a balloon in a warm room, the air inside will be slightly less dense than the cooler air outside. Ever notice a balloon looking a bit saggy on a cold day? That’s because the air inside has contracted due to the lower temperature!

Density: Packing the Air In

Air density refers to how much air is packed into a given space. Denser air is heavier than less dense air. Altitude and temperature both affect air density. At higher altitudes, the air is less dense because there’s less air pressing down from above. Similarly, as we mentioned earlier, warmer air is less dense than cooler air. So, a balloon inflated in a cool basement will have denser air inside than a balloon inflated on a hot, sunny day. This difference in density, though minimal in air-filled balloons, is a crucial concept in understanding how hot air balloons work!

Size (Diameter/Volume): Measuring Up

Size matters, especially when it comes to balloons. A small balloon might be perfect for a kid’s party favor, but if you’re trying to create a show-stopping archway, you’ll need something much bigger. Size dictates how eye-catching your balloon is, and its suitability for different events.

Here are a few standard sizes you might encounter:

  • 5-inch Balloons: These little guys are often used in balloon drops or as accents in larger decorations.
  • 9-inch Balloons: A classic size, great for general decorations and kids’ parties.
  • 11/12-inch Balloons: Your go-to for creating balloon bouquets and impressive displays.
  • Larger Specialty Balloons (16-inch+): These balloons really make a statement! Perfect for grand openings, photo backdrops, or any event where you want to grab attention.

Did you know that the size also affects how much air you’ll need to inflate the balloon? Makes sense, right? A bigger balloon means more air, and potentially more huffing and puffing on your part if you’re going manual.

Thickness: Durability and Lifespan

Ever wonder why some balloons pop the second you look at them sideways? The answer: thickness. The thickness of a balloon directly impacts its lifespan and ability to withstand the elements. A thicker balloon will generally last longer and is less prone to bursting.

Optimal thickness varies depending on the intended use:

  • For outdoor events, a thicker balloon is essential to withstand wind and sun.
  • For indoor decorations, a slightly thinner balloon might suffice, but still avoid the super flimsy ones if you want them to last!

The quality of the material is also key. Even a thick balloon made from low-grade latex might not hold up as well as a thinner balloon made from high-quality material.

Choking Hazards: Little Ones and Balloons Don’t Always Mix

Ever watch a toddler with a balloon? It’s cute, right? Until they start gnawing on it. Deflated or burst balloons are serious choking hazards, especially for kids under eight. They might try to swallow pieces, and that stretchy latex can easily block their airways. It’s a scary thought, so here’s the lowdown:

  • Supervision is Key: Never leave young children unattended with balloons. Like, never.
  • Cutting is Caring: As soon as a balloon pops, gather up the pieces and snip them into smaller bits before tossing them. This makes it way less likely they’ll become a choking hazard.
  • Age Matters: For the littlest partygoers, consider skipping latex balloons altogether. If you do use them, make sure they’re fully inflated and keep a close watch.

Latex Allergies: When Balloons Become the Enemy

For some folks, latex balloons aren’t just a decoration; they’re an allergen bomb. Latex allergies can range from mild skin irritation to serious respiratory problems. If you’re hosting a party, it’s always good to be aware of this.

  • Foil and Plastic to the Rescue: The great news is that foil (Mylar) and plastic balloons are fantastic alternatives. They’re just as festive and won’t trigger those nasty allergic reactions.
  • Be Allergy Aware: Keep an eye out for symptoms like hives, itching, sneezing, or difficulty breathing. If someone starts showing these signs, move them away from the balloons and seek medical help if needed.
  • Communicate: When sending your child to a party, it is always a good idea to check in with your party organizer to see if there is any allergies they should be aware of.

Bursting Hazards: Loud Noises and Projectile Latex

Balloons popping can be startling, but they can also be dangerous. Overinflated balloons are just waiting to explode, sending shrapnel flying and creating a loud bang that can even damage hearing. Believe it or not, bursting balloons can cause hearing damage, especially if it happens close to your ear. Protect your ears and more:

  • Don’t Overdo It: Follow the inflation guidelines on the package. A slightly smaller balloon is much better than a ticking time bomb.
  • Sharp Objects are the Enemy: Keep balloons away from anything sharp. And teach kids not to squeeze them too hard!
  • Ear Protection: If you’re inflating a ton of balloons with an air compressor, consider wearing earplugs, especially if you have sensitive hearing.

Biodegradability (of Latex Balloons): The Natural Decomposition Process

So, can these joyful orbs actually disappear back into nature? Well, latex balloons get a qualified “yes.”

  • Examining Latex Biodegradability: Latex, being a natural rubber, can biodegrade. Think of it like a fallen leaf – it eventually breaks down.
  • Decomposition Rate Factors: However, don’t expect them to vanish overnight! Sunlight, moisture, and soil conditions significantly impact how quickly they decompose. A balloon in a landfill? Probably taking its sweet time. One exposed to the elements? Faster, but still not instant.
  • Latex vs. the Competition: Now, the tricky part: Comparing latex to foil (Mylar) and plastic balloons. Foil and plastic? Not biodegradable. These materials will hang around much, much longer, contributing to environmental concerns. So, latex wins this round, but responsible disposal is still key!

Littering Concerns: Protecting Our Environment

This is where the party gets a little less fun. Releasing balloons into the air might seem like a grand gesture, but it can have serious consequences.

  • Environmental Impact: Imagine balloons drifting into oceans, forests, or fields. It’s not a pretty picture. Wildlife can mistake balloon pieces for food, leading to choking or digestive problems. Plus, those colorful scraps pollute our beautiful waterways and landscapes.
  • Responsible Disposal Methods: Okay, deep breath. We can be better! Let’s commit to responsible disposal:

    • Cut up the balloons: Snipping balloons into smaller pieces renders them less dangerous to animals.
    • Trash ’em properly: Toss the remains into designated trash receptacles. Keep our streets and parks balloon-free!
  • Community Clean-Up: Want to take it a step further? Organize or join local clean-up events. It’s a fantastic way to give back to the community and make a real difference!

How does the pressure inside a balloon filled with air compare to the pressure outside the balloon?

The pressure inside the balloon is greater than the pressure outside. The balloon’s elastic material exerts inward force, thus raising internal pressure. The air molecules inside the balloon possess kinetic energy, which creates outward force. Atmospheric pressure exerts inward force on the balloon’s outer surface. The balloon maintains equilibrium when internal pressure equals external pressure plus elastic tension.

What happens to the volume of a balloon filled with air when the temperature of the air inside is increased?

The volume of the balloon increases when the temperature rises. Heating the air increases kinetic energy of air molecules. The molecules collide more forcefully and more frequently with the balloon walls. This increased collision rate expands the balloon, increasing its volume. Charles’s Law states volume is directly proportional to temperature at constant pressure.

How does the density of air inside a balloon change as the balloon is inflated with more air?

The density of air inside the balloon increases as more air is added. Density is mass per unit volume. Inflating the balloon adds more air mass inside. The volume of the balloon also increases, but at a slower rate. The net effect is a higher mass concentration, thus greater density.

What causes a balloon filled with air to float upwards in the atmosphere, and under what conditions will it rise?

Buoyant force causes the balloon to float upwards. The buoyant force is equal to the weight of air displaced by the balloon. The balloon will rise if the buoyant force exceeds the balloon’s weight. A lower density of air inside the balloon compared to outside air helps it ascend. Heating the air inside the balloon reduces internal density, hence promoting lift.
